Formtilstånd
Formtilstånd is a Swedish term that translates to "form of state" or "state form." It refers to the fundamental structure and organization of a country's political system, encompassing the nature of its government, the distribution of power, and the relationship between the state and its citizens. This concept is crucial for understanding the historical development and contemporary characteristics of different nations.
